Skip to content
GitLab
Menu
Projects
Groups
Snippets
/
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in
Toggle navigation
Menu
Open sidebar
delroth
Tor
Commits
4259bc36
Commit
4259bc36
authored
Apr 27, 2022
by
David Goulet
🤘
Browse files
doc: Clarify the release process for a first stable
Signed-off-by:
David Goulet
<
dgoulet@torproject.org
>
parent
fb4c80f7
Changes
1
Hide whitespace changes
Inline
Side-by-side
doc/HACKING/ReleasingTor.md
View file @
4259bc36
...
...
@@ -132,14 +132,17 @@ do the following:
### New Stable
1.
Create the
`maint-x.y.z`
and
`release-x.y.z`
branches and update the
`./scripts/git/git-list-tor-branches.sh`
with the new version.
1.
Create the
`maint-x.y.z`
and
`release-x.y.z`
branches at the version
tag. Then update the
`./scripts/git/git-list-tor-branches.sh`
with the
new version.
2.
Add the new version in
`./scripts/ci/ci-driver.sh`
.
3.
Forward port the ChangeLog and ReleaseNotes into main branch. Remove any
change logs of stable releases in ReleaseNotes
.
2.
Update
`./scripts/git/git-list-tor-branches.sh`
and
`./scripts/ci/ci-driver.sh`
with the new version in
`maint-x.y.z`
and
then merge forward into main. (If you haven't pushed remotely the new
branches, merge the local branch)
.
3.
In
`main`
, bump version to the next series:
`tor-x.y.0-alpha-dev`
and
then tag it:
`git tag -s tor-x.y.0-alpha-dev`
## Appendix: An alternative means to notify packagers
...
...
Write
Preview
Supports
Markdown
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ment